Transaction af08616571d8ccca62eee3bcb30d123686ffbb7e91ee0c5896a349d7ef710005
1 Input
1 Output
-
af08616571d8ccca62eee3bcb30d123686ffbb7e91ee0c5896a349d7ef710005:0
- value
- 368366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02847d22f3ea3c78b70c69b3b3ec9ec5ed73574d OP_EQUAL
- address
- 31vKzQpzcezUccpPoJ5wmiXAqXGmEpnTWZ